Output 21e64dc727cb8689ea7a9afe719f3aeeec69bfc958934fd82baad7aa44256850:1

value
80600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d704bde95664069fed98334779fa2655737db114 OP_EQUAL
address
3MHvtFpDRcfS4cHYCqhQAQ3mq5Z4x1pNUG
transaction
21e64dc727cb8689ea7a9afe719f3aeeec69bfc958934fd82baad7aa44256850
spent
true